was a prominent online platform that specialized in providing unauthorized downloads of Bollywood, Hollywood, and regional Indian movies . During its peak around 2019 , the site capitalized on the massive global demand for free digital media by hosting mobile-friendly video formats. While it attracted millions of monthly users, it operated as a pirate network, defying strict international copyright regulations and facing constant targeting from law enforcement agencies.
